Combination of card Seven of Swords and card The Sun

The Sun and Seven of Swords in an upright position – a combination promising success without tricks. Bright light dispels shadows of doubt, rendering any cunning pointless. Old misunderstandings dissolve like morning mist under the rising sun. The path to goals is now open and honest, with transparency in relationships becoming the key advantage. Past secrets lose their power, giving way to clarity.

Combination of reversed card Seven of Swords and card The Sun

The direct Sun and reversed Seven of Swords leave no room for manipulation. Sunlight mercilessly exposes any tricks, and the overturned swords point to the failure of hidden schemes. The truth will come out anyway – sooner or later. It's better to play fair from the start than to blush later from being exposed. Honesty will save your energy and reputation.

Combination of card Seven of Swords and reversed card The Sun

A Reversed Sun with an Upright Seven of Swords – murky waters where someone is fishing. Clouded perception blinds a person to the tricks around them. Instead of direct paths, winding trails leading nowhere are chosen. Deception thrives where clarity is lacking. Take a closer look at those nearby – not all smiles are genuine.

Combination of reversed card Seven of Swords and reversed card The Sun

Reversed Sun and Seven of Swords warn: things aren't what they seem. Attempts at deception are failing but continue to multiply. Someone is persistently trying to hide the truth – almost like trying to hide an elephant under a rug. Stay alert – not everything that glitters is gold. Blind trust can lead to disappointment.
